Currently studying a Professional Doctorate in Education with Cardiff University Jeannette is planning to conduct research into the impact of all-through schooling and the absence of transition on vulnerable groups such as pupils with SEN and looked after children. Jeannette is currently a Coach for the education charity Achievement for All which focuses its intervention on the lowest achieving 20% of pupils.

With 10 years experience in secondary schools, Jeannette’s areas of specialism are inclusion, whole school behaviour, interventions and alternative provision.  She was part of a small team involved in a start up inner city Academy in 2009 which went on to be judged Outstanding by Ofsted in 2011. Graduating in 2004 with a BA Hons in Politics & International Studies at Warwick University, Jeannette went on to train as a History teacher at Oxford University then took a second specialism in PSHE and has led on whole school Citizenship and PSHE curriculum for many years.

Jeannette went on to study a Masters at the Institute of Education in Social Justice & Education, completing research into young people’s participation in pupil voice and democratic practices.  She enjoys working in schools to develop staff capacity using different models of coaching and in designing bespoke participatory training workshops.
